As a Network Technician on the Wireless Connectivity Solutions team, the incumbent will work with the team to design, implement, and maintain equipment installation projects in various areas of the country.
**Prior Military experience preferred**
Responsibilities include:
- Set up, monitor, and upgrade system equipment to include wireless transceivers, wireless controllers, network access control systems and guest user systems
- Maintain the network environment of an installed system
- Provide up to level-three technical support for system issues reported by customer
- Collect data and feedback from clients regarding functionality
- Collaborate with engineers to resolve system and equipment configuration issues
- Identify, rectify, and replace malfunctioning equipment
- Support testing and configuration of new equipment
- Set up client security software on common devices
- Terminate and route cables inside equipment enclosures and mounted equipment
- Maintain and manage computer networks and related computing environments including systems software, applications software, hardware, and configurations
- Troubleshoot, diagnose, and resolve hardware, software, and other network and system problems
- Replace faulty network hardware components when required
- Maintain, configure, and monitor virus protection software and email applications
- Monitor network performance to determine if adjustments need to be made
- Confer with network users about solving existing system problems
- Operate master consoles to monitor the performance of networks and computer systems
- Perform disaster preparedness and recovery operations when required
- Perform other duties within this scope as assigned
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ree in an IT or Engineering related field; or 4 years direct experience supporting IT systems
- Exceptional degree of customer-service orientation
- Security , Network , CCNA certifications a plus
- Team oriented, with the ability to work in a fast-paced environment
- Active DoD Secret clearance, or the ability to obtain a clearance
